Developing in Boise



Capital City Development Corporation, as Boise's redevelopment agency, guides redevelopment efforts within city-approved urban renewal districts. Activities in each district are guided by urban renewal plans, also approved by the City Council. Currently there are three districts downtown: the Central, River Street/Myrtle Street and Westside Downtown.

CCDC's redevelopment projects typically involve collaborative partnerships with other public agencies and with private entities. The development toolkit includes professional master planning; historic preservation; cultural investments; infrastructure investments such as parking garages, streetscapes, utilities or transit; financial access; facility development and others. CCDC frequently works with the private sector to provide development incentives to achieve larger urban design goals-for example pedestrian-friendly streets, public art and more downtown residential options. CCDC's public investments typically trigger other private investment; in the original Central District the public-to-private Investment ratio has been 1:5.
